Wearing the Earphones

  1. Carefully wear the earphones with the 'L' mark in your left ear, and the one with the 'R' mark in your right ear.
  2. Twist the earphones up into the ear canal while inserting, until outside noise is blocked out.

Important:

If there seems to be a lack of low-frequency response (bass), it means the ear-tip is not forming a tight seal. Push the earphones deeper into the ear canal or try changing to different ear-tips.

Removing the Earphones:

Grasp the body of the earphones and gently twist to remove. Do not pull on the cable to remove earphones.

Two Step Bluetooth Connection

  1. Long press the power button to switch on the Bluetooth earphones.
  2. Red and Blue lights will start flashing alternately.
  3. Turn on Bluetooth in your mobile phone and connect "NU Republic" to pair.

Parameters

ParameterValue
Bluetooth Version5.0
Bluetooth ProtocolsHSP, HFP, A2DP, AVRCP
Working Distance10m
Music Play Time8 hours*
Standby Time200 hours*
Charging Time2 hours*
Battery Capacity140 mAh
Playing SystemiOS and Android
Frequency20Hz - 20kHz

Charging the Battery

Diagram illustrating the charging process, showing the earphones' charging cable connecting to a USB adapter, a laptop, and a power outlet symbol.

The earphones are partially charged at the factory, so they can be turned on and used normally. But before using them for the first time, make sure the earphones are fully charged.

  1. Connect the charging port to any USB charging adapter or computer USB port (current does not exceed 1A).
  2. The LED indicator turns red when charging.
  3. When the LED indicator turns blue, the battery is full.

Notes

If you do not charge the earphones for a long time, the battery life will be greatly shortened. It is recommended that you charge the earphones at least once a month.

Choosing Perfect Eartips

It provides ear-tips in small/medium/large three sizes, made from premium grade rubber. Select an ear-tip that provides the best fit and sound isolation. It should be easy to insert, fit comfortably, and easy to remove.
